MK Dons will be paying tribute to the serving and past members of the armed forces with a pre-match ceremony prior to Saturday’s Sky Bet League One clash with Cambridge United.

As part of the Club’s Armed Forces Day, MK Dons ask supporters to take their seats well in time for kick-off in order to observe a period of reflection in tribute to those defending our country as well as those who have made the ultimate sacrifice in duty.

Players will enter the pitch through a guard of honour before lining up, alongside cadets, around the centre circle for a minute’s silence. The minute’s silence will begin with a rendition of The Last Post and will end with a rendition of Reveille.

The Clubs asks that you join us in the minute’s silence and also remain silent while also observing The Last Post and Reveille.

We will remember them.
